rr__//,\II <br />Kent Gorham <br />'jhW <br />,d?,aaon, <br />Wmg and <br />Division of Reclamation, Mining and Safety <br />1313 Sherman Street, Room 215 <br />Denver, Colorado 80203 <br />RE: Northfield Mine <br />Permit No. C-2006-085 <br />Technical Revision No. 01 (TR-01) <br />Dear Mr. Gorham, <br />Northfield Partners LLC (Northfield) requests a Technical Revision to the approved <br />coal mine application for Northfield Mine in Fremont County, Colorado. This revision <br />proposes changes to the approved layout and design of the surface mine facilities <br />and mine access. <br />Subsequent to approval of the mining permit, Northfield has conducted engineering <br />studies of alternative configurations to access the coal seam. These studies provided <br />a design that is economically feasible and improves mine safety that included a main <br />slope that is less steep, and longer than originally proposed, and an additional <br />ventilation shaft. <br />Increasing the slope length required a minor change in the location of the portal <br />entrance and modification to the location of the surrounding facility area. The <br />proposed portal site is approximately 780 feet north of the original location. In order <br />to utilize the portal location, the surface facility area is shifted northward <br />approximately 450 feet.
